Mitsuru Kodama is a scholar working on Strategy and Management, Management of Technology and Innovation and Information Systems. According to data from OpenAlex, Mitsuru Kodama has authored 111 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 52 papers in Strategy and Management, 25 papers in Management of Technology and Innovation and 13 papers in Information Systems. Recurrent topics in Mitsuru Kodama's work include Innovation and Knowledge Management (49 papers), Business Strategy and Innovation (32 papers) and University-Industry-Government Innovation Models (15 papers). Mitsuru Kodama is often cited by papers focused on Innovation and Knowledge Management (49 papers), Business Strategy and Innovation (32 papers) and University-Industry-Government Innovation Models (15 papers). Mitsuru Kodama collaborates with scholars based in Japan, United States and United Kingdom. Mitsuru Kodama's co-authors include Ikujiro Nonaka, Florian Kohlbacher, Ayano Hirose, Vesa Peltokorpi, Jun Hasegawa, Yasunori Baba, Jun Suzuki, Masahiko Yoshimoto, Atsushi Kawaguchi and Kazuto Yamazaki and has published in prestigious journals such as Journal of The Electrochemical Society, International Journal of Heat and Mass Transfer and Journal of Management Studies.
